REMOTE POSITION / CLAIMS PROCESSOR
Follows procedures to process death claim transactions by corresponding with agents, beneficiaries, and other departments regarding policies
Willingness to learn new payment processes and/or other processes within death claims depending on where the need is on any given day
Responsible for the accurate handling and timely execution of any policy worked
Ensure transactions are processed on our administrative systems accurately and in a timeframe considered suitable by MetLife guidelines
Must provide an elite customer service experience via letters or phone calls made internally or externally
Continuously evaluate and identify opportunities to drive process improvements that positively impact the customer's experience
High School Diploma completed
2+ years of relevant life insurance death claims business experience
Claims processing experience
Working knowledge of life insurance products and applicable policies, procedures, and guidelines
Microsoft Office and MS Teams work experience
Great typing and documenting skills
Empathy, sensibility and high sense or touch are necessary for the type of support we provide to our customers
Inbound/outbound customer service experience and communication skills are required
Great ability to multitask between clients applications and DXC systems
Bachelors Degree is preferred
Remote Laptop, Docking Station, Monitors, Headset will be provided
Schedule: Monday Friday 7:30am to 4pm EST would be preferred
This position is fully remote within the United States only
